Assessment of frailty and inflammatory burden index as predictors of postoperative IAA in elderly appendectomy patients

摘要

Background

Postoperative intra-abdominal abscesses (IAA) remain a significant complication after laparoscopic appendectomy for acute appendicitis. This study investigates the roles of the 5-item modified Frailty Index (mFI-5) and Inflammatory Burden Index (IBI) in predicting IAA risk.

Methods

This retrospective study analyzed elderly patients who underwent laparoscopic appendectomy from 2015 to 2025. Patients were assessed for frailty using mFI-5 and systemic inflammation using IBI. We collected demographic, clinical, and laboratory data, and univariate and multivariate logistic regression were performed to identify risk factors for IAA. A nomogram was developed based on significant variables from the multivariate analysis by R.

Results

A total of 428 patients were included, with 43 (10.0%) developing IAA. Multivariate analysis revealed that perforated appendicitis (OR: 2.950, 95% CI: 1.210–7.197, P = 0.017), higher mFI-5 scores (OR: 3.370, 95% CI: 1.956–5.806, P < 0.001), and elevated IBI values (OR: 1.104, 95% CI: 1.027–1.186, P = 0.007) were independently associated with IAA. The nomogram, developed from these factors, showed good discriminatory ability with an AUC of 0.776.

Conclusions

Perforated appendicitis, mFI-5 and IBI are reliable predictors of IAA in elderly patients after laparoscopic appendectomy. The nomogram incorporating these factors can effectively guide clinical decision-making and identify high-risk patients.
